Coherent Corp. (NYSE: COHR) CFO sells 1,000 shares in 10b5-1 trade
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Coherent Corp. Chief Financial Officer Sherri R Luther sold 1,000 shares of common stock on 2026-07-22 at $306.68 per share in a sale described as an open-market or private transaction. The sale was made under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on November 13, 2025, and she now directly holds 67,475 shares.

Rule 10b5-1 trading plan regulatory
"The sale transaction was eff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an"
A Rule 10b5-1 trading plan is a pre-arranged schedule that allows company insiders to buy or sell stock at specific times, even if they have inside information. It helps prevent accusations of unfair trading by making these transactions look planned and transparent, rather than sneaky or illegal.
